Transaction 98b76320321f072a1351161424449b1de59ec4f75fba8df50ac3e545d7196312

1 Input
2 Outputs
  • 98b76320321f072a1351161424449b1de59ec4f75fba8df50ac3e545d7196312:0
  • value  28987309
    address  3BS4MsShASZFFszbZb53VjFr32yPTXPu2V
  • 98b76320321f072a1351161424449b1de59ec4f75fba8df50ac3e545d7196312:1
  • value  505400
    address  1ErtrW3TFRtCsQ9kUcQEZerZ2aiTbRtvi9